The 2008 Beeston BBQ

Last Saturday was our yearly BBQ an example has been loaded onto UTUBE..... it is worth watching!!

<click here> Pablo, Lee and Lucy have SOME talent!

The weather was mixed but mostly dry, the wind was blowing but still 400 of you came to enjoy the event! We started off with a superb BBQ. The food was cooked by the customers we like to call the usual suspects! As usual, as with all the other years they all did a superb job cooking burgers and sausages with onion.... thank you for your help. Nicola was as normal completely at home on the microphone organising us all. Beestons Got Talent, our main event was fantasic and all 18 acts were amazing. The winner was Hugo Ambrose 4 years old who played a passage of Mozart on an organ...well done to you Hugo! Second and third well done also! I entered but fluffed by lines and went blank... well it is hard with 400 hundred people in front of you!! There were dancing troops, singers, juggling act, piano and singing... just to name a few. The judges included Timothy Hay MD of Beeston Regis and Becky Jago of Local TV and Radio fame. On behalf the Management of Beeston Regis Thank you all for entering and taking part. The afternoon finished with a rather drunken... some of you!..... quiz which involved animal noises!!!
